WeRide to Trial Run Its Driveless Road Sweeper in Singapore by End of 2024
On June 20, 2024, WeRide, a global leader in autonomous driving technology, announced a collaboration with Chye Thiam Maintenance (CTM), a renowned sanitation company in Singapore, to advance the commercial deployment of WeRide's autonomous sanitation vehicles ("WeRide Sanitation Vehicles") in Singapore. The initial batch of WeRide Sanitation Vehicles has successfully arrived in Singapore and began safety testing, with plans to start trial run on public road by the end of 2024.
CTM is one of the largest and top-ranked cleaning and waste management companies in Singapore. It maintains strong and longstanding cooperative relationships with the Singapore government, as well as with the entertainment and tourism sectors. As a key participant and leading player in Singapore's sanitation industry, CTM plays a pivotal role in maintaining the city's cleanliness and hygiene standards.
WeRide is a global leader in autonomous driving technology, engaged in research, testing, and operational activities across 30 cities in 7 countries worldwide. With a focus on smart sanitation, freight logistics, and urban mobility, WeRide boasts a range of mature, pre-installed mass-produced products and extensive experience in commercial deployments. Since September 2022, WeRide has successfully launched smart sanitation operations in multiple global cities including Guangzhou, Shenzhen, Dalian, Beijing, and Zhengzhou. These initiatives have contributed significantly to local efforts in establishing sample smart city projects and enhancing urban living, working, and leisure environments.

As WeRide's flagship product in smart sanitation scenarios, the WeRide Sanitation Vehicle is equipped with WeRide's proprietary autonomous driving software and hardware architecture. It features multiple high-precision sensors and artificial intelligent algorithms, enabling them to efficiently perform urban sanitation tasks, including road sweeping, water spraying, and disinfection. The vehicle can autonomously detect road conditions, avoid pedestrians and obstacles, ensuring safety and reliability while enhancing cleaning efficiency. Additionally, the WeRide Sanitation Vehicle operates on pure electric drive, reducing carbon dioxide emissions by nearly 10,000 kilograms per month on average. This commitment to low-carbon emissions supports Singapore's green transformation in sanitation practices.
The WeRide Sanitation Vehicle has received high praise from Singapore government officials, businesses, and prominent media outlets such as MotherShip, The Straits Times, NewsSWSV, and Ground NEWS.
Mr. Chee Hong Tat, Singapore's Minister for Transport and Second Minister for Finance, expressed confidence on LinkedIn that innovative sanitation technologies could assist cleaning companies in boosting productivity.
Mr. Lim Jo Hann, Senior Vice President (Operations) of CTM, has full confidence in the safety features of the WeRide Sanitation Vehicle. He revealed plans for initial operations in the Marina Bay area once road permits are secured.
